Material Selection
Picking the appropriate roofing materials is vital for the long life and performance of your new roofing system. You'll want to think about factors like climate, sturdiness, and looks when making your choice.
Asphalt roof shingles are preferred for their affordability and ease of installation, yet they may not last as long in harsh weather conditions.
If you live in an area with heavy snowfall or high winds, metal roof covering could be a much better choice. It's very resilient and can withstand extreme weather condition, plus it comes in numerous styles and colors.
For an extra environment-friendly option, take into consideration slate or ceramic tile roofing, which can last for decades and include an one-of-a-kind look to your home.
Do not fail to remember to think of the weight of the products. Some roofings might call for additional reinforcement if you choose much heavier products like slate or ceramic tile.
Also, check local building codes and policies to guarantee your picked products conform.
Lastly, budget is critical; locate an equilibrium between high quality and expense to guarantee you're making a smart investment.

Remove old shingles and check for damages, fixing any kind of weak spots to make certain a strong structure.
Next off, lay down a waterproof underlayment, overlapping the sides to avoid leakages.
As soon as the underlayment's in position, you can start mounting your picked roof covering material. If you're using shingles, start at the bottom side of the roofing and function your way up, surprising the seams for better coverage. Secure each tile with nails, adhering to the maker's standards for spacing and fasteners.
For metal roofs, connect the panels beginning with the most affordable point, ensuring they interlock effectively. Use screws or clips created for your details metal kind, and bear in mind the seam positioning.
